My dad used to live at Arthur and Estelle Sidewater House. It was a nice little place. He liked it there. They kept it clean. They offered them outside trips, but he didn't go. There was only one staff member who sat in the office. I liked it and it was worth the money that we paid. That building was really cute. They even had little patio sectors. They were allowed to have small pets there. They had a library inside. They had outdoor children's stuff so that the families could come and have a picnic with their family members. They offer meals. The rabbi will come out and do prayers. They've got a community room that was able to do arts and crafts. They had an area where they could play the piano.
